First things first, let's investigate how to access your PC's specifications. A common approach is to use the built-in system information tools provided by operating systems like Windows and macOS. These programs offer a comprehensive snapshot of key components such as CPU, RAM, storage capacity, and graphics card. Alternatively, you can utilize third-party software that provides more detailed analysis and performance metrics.

  • Delve into your system's BIOS (Basic Input/Output System) settings for initial hardware information.
  • Utilize the Windows "System Information" tool by searching for it in the Start menu.
  • On macOS, open "About This Mac" from the Apple menu to view essential specs.

Understanding your PC's specifications allows you to fine-tune its performance, identify potential bottlenecks, and make informed decisions about upgrades or repairs.

Diving into PC Specs

Curious about what makes your computer tick? Unlocking your PC specs is a snap. Start by navigating to your system information. This frequently involves searching for "system information" in the Windows search bar or using the "About Your Mac" option on macOS. Once you're there, scroll through the listed components to get a comprehensive overview of your hardware setup. Pay close attention to the processor (CPU), RAM, storage type, and graphics card – these are the key elements that shape your PC's performance.

For, utilize third-party tools like CPU-Z or Speccy. These programs provide more in-depth information about your components, including their clock speeds and temperatures. Remember, understanding your PC specs empowers you to make informed decisions about upgrades and troubleshooting.
